What are the responsibilities of a married women towards her parents?
Praise
be to Allaah.
The responsibilities of a married woman towards her parents
are like those of any other woman. The rights of the parents remain
both before and after marriage, but obedience to the husband takes precedence
over obedience to the parents if there is a conflict.
If the command of the parents conflicts with the command
of the husband, then what takes precedence is the command of the husband.
But the Muslim husband and the Muslim wife must strive to avoid conflict
with the parents, and strive to achieve harmony between them and their
parents.
One of the matters to which the married woman should
pay attention concerning her parents is that she should strive to visit
them from time to time, and give them appropriate gifts even if they
have no real material value. She should try to avoid letting her children’s
misbehaviour annoy them when visiting them, and avoid telling them about
marital disagreements.

If her parents need money and she is able to spend on
them, then it is obligatory for her to spend on them as much as she
is able to. If she does not have money of her own, but she intercedes
with her husband, if he has money, to help her parents, then she will
be rewarded for that in sha Allah. This is part of honouring her parents.
